Win10安装MySQL5.6详细教程
win10怎么安装mysql5.6

首页 2025-06-11 07:18:26



Win10系统下MySQL 5.6的安装指南 在Windows 10系统上安装MySQL 5.6版本,虽然步骤稍显繁琐,但只要按照指南一步一步操作,即可轻松完成

    本文将详细介绍从下载、安装到配置MySQL 5.6的全过程,确保您能够顺利在Win10系统上运行这一经典数据库管理系统

     一、准备工作 在安装MySQL 5.6之前,您需要做好以下准备工作: 1.系统环境:确保您的Windows 10系统是最新版本,或者至少是一个稳定版本

    同时,关闭不必要的程序,尤其是杀毒软件,以避免在安装过程中产生冲突

     2.下载地址:访问MySQL官方网站(【MySQL下载页面】(https://downloads.mysql.com/archives/community/)),下载适用于Windows系统的MySQL 5.6安装包

    您可以选择下载MSI安装包或ZIP压缩包,根据个人喜好和安装需求来决定

     二、下载安装包 1.下载MSI安装包: - 访问MySQL官方网站,进入下载页面

     - 在“Windows (x86, 64-bit), ZIP Archive”或“Windows(x86, 32-bit), ZIP Archive”下方,选择适合您系统的版本(通常建议选择64位版本)

    但注意,这里我们为了讲解MSI安装过程,选择MSI安装包下载链接

     - 点击下载按钮,保存安装包到本地磁盘

     2.下载ZIP压缩包: - 同样在MySQL下载页面,找到“Windows (x86, 64-bit),Installer (MSI)”或对应32位系统的安装包链接(但这里我们主要讲解ZIP包安装,所以选择ZIP链接)

     - 点击下载,将ZIP压缩包保存到您的电脑上

     三、安装MySQL 5.6 方法一:通过MSI安装包安装 1.双击安装包:找到下载好的MSI安装包,双击打开

     2.接受协议:在弹出的安装向导中,阅读并接受许可协议,然后点击“Next”

     3.选择安装类型:选择“Custom”自定义安装,以便更好地控制安装组件

    点击“Next”

     4.选择组件:在组件选择界面,勾选“MySQL Server 5.6 x64”,以及其他您需要的组件(如MySQL Workbench等,如果不需要可以不选)

    选择安装路径,点击“Next”

     5.执行环境检查:安装程序会检查必要的环境依赖,点击“Execute”执行环境安装

     6.安装MySQL Server:环境依赖安装完成后,继续点击“Next”进行MySQL Server的安装

    再次点击“Execute”开始安装过程

     7.配置服务器:安装完成后,进入配置界面

    设置服务器类型(通常选择“Development Machine”),设置端口号(默认为3306),并勾选“Advanced Options”以访问更多配置选项

     8.设置root密码:在“Root Password”部分,为您的root用户设置一个强密码

    同时,可以添加新用户(可选)

     9.Windows服务配置:设置MySQL的Windows服务名称,并勾选“Install MySQL as a Windows Service”以及“Start the MySQL Server at System Startup”选项,以便MySQL随系统启动

     10. 应用配置:检查所有配置无误后,点击“Execute”应用配置

    完成后,点击“Finish”退出安装向导

     方法二:通过ZIP压缩包安装 1.解压压缩包:将下载的ZIP压缩包解压到您指定的文件夹中

    例如,解压到“D:MySQLMySQL Server 5.6”

     2.配置环境变量:为了方便在命令行中启动MySQL,需要将MySQL的bin目录添加到系统的PATH环境变量中

     - 右击“此电脑”,选择“属性”

     - 点击“高级系统设置”,然后点击“环境变量”

     - 在“系统变量”部分,找到并编辑“Path”变量,将MySQL的bin目录路径(如“D:MySQLMySQL Server 5.6bin”)添加到Path中

     3.初始化数据目录:打开命令提示符(以管理员身份运行),并运行初始化命令

    例如: shell mysqld --initialize-insecure --basedir=D:MySQLMySQL Server 5.6 --datadir=D:MySQLMySQL Server 5.6data 注意:`--initialize-insecure`选项会创建一个没有密码的root用户

    为了安全起见,建议在安装完成后立即设置密码

     4.安装MySQL服务:使用以下命令将MySQL安装为Windows服务: shell mysqld --install MySQL56 --defaults-file=D:MySQLMySQL Server 5.6my.ini 其中,“MySQL56”是服务的名称,您可以根据需要更改

    `my.ini`是MySQL的配置文件,如果解压的文件夹中没有该文件,您需要手动创建一个

     5.启动MySQL服务:使用以下命令启动MySQL服务: shell net start MySQL56 6.设置root密码:连接到MySQL服务器后,使用以下命令为root用户设置密码: sql SET PASSWORD FOR root@localhost = PASSWORD(您的密码); 四、配置MySQL 5.6 1.编辑my.ini文件:找到MySQL的配置文件`my.ini`(如果之前未创建,则现在需要手动创建)

    该文件通常位于MySQL安装目录下的根文件夹中

    使用文本编辑器(如Notepad++)打开该文件,并进行以下配置: ini 【client】 default-character-set = utf8mb4 【mysql】 default-character-set = utf8mb4 【mysqld】 basedir = D:/MySQL/MySQL Server 5.6/ datadir = D:/MySQL/MySQL Server 5.6/data port = 3306 character-set-server = utf8mb4 default-storage-engine = INNODB max_connections = 200 其他配置选项... 注意:根据您的实际安装路径和配置需求,调整上述路径和选项

     2.重启MySQL服务:每次修改配置文件后,都需要重启MySQL服务以使更改生效

    使用以下命令重启服务: shell net stop MySQL56 net start MySQL56 3.验证安装:打开命令提示符,输入`mysql -u root -p`并回车

    输入您之前设置的root密码后,如果成功连接到MySQL服务器,则说明安装和配置均已完成

     五、常见问题与解决 1.防火墙设置:确保Windows防火墙允许MySQL的3306端口进行通信

    如果需要远程连接MySQL服务器,请在防火墙中打开该端口

     2.字符编码问题:如果在连接MySQL时出现字符编码问题,请检查`my.ini`文件中的字符集设置,并确保客户端和服务器的字符集一致

     3.服务启动失败:如果MySQL服务无法启动,请检查`my.ini`文件的配置是否正确,以及MySQL的安装路径和数据目录是否存在且可访问

     4.权限问题:如果遇到权限相关的错误,请确保您以管理员身份运行命令提示符或MySQL客户端

     六、总结 通过以上步骤,您应该能够在Windows 10系统上成功安装并配置MySQL 5.6

    虽然安装过程可能稍显复杂,但只要按照指南一步一步操作,就能够顺利完成

    MySQL 5.6作为一个经典且稳定的数据库管理系统,能够满足大多数应用场景的需求

    希望本文对您有所帮助!

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道